Abstract

See full text

An isolated, porcine .alpha.1-6 fucosyltransferase having the following physico-chemical properties: (1) action: transferring fucose from guanosine diphosphate-fucose to a hydroxy group at 6-position of GluNAc closest to R of a receptor (GlcNAc.beta.1-2Man.alpha.1-6)(GlcNAc.beta.1-2Man.alpha.1-3)Man.beta.1-4G-lcNAc.beta.1-4GlucNAc-R wherein R is an asparagine residue or a peptide chain carrying said residue, whereby to form (GlcNAc.beta.1-2Man.alpha.1-6)-(GlcNAc.beta.1-2Man.alpha.1-3)Man.alpha.1--4GlcNAc.beta.1-4(Fuc.alpha.1-6)GlucNAc-R (2) optimum pH: about 7.0 (3) pH stability: retains activity after 5 hours of treatment at 4.degree. C. at a pH range of 4.0-10.0 (4) optimum temperature: about 30-37.degree. C. (5) inhibition or activation: no requirement for divalent metal for expression of activity; no inhibition of activity in the presence of 5 mM EDTA (6) molecular weight: about 60,000 by SDS-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is is provided. An isolated polynucleotide encoding porcine .alpha.1-6 fucosyltransferase is also provided. Expression vectors comprising a polynucleotide encoding porcine .alpha.1-6 fucosyltransferase are also provided.
